#3342bb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#3342bb is composed of 20% red, 25.9% green and 73.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 72.7% cyan, 64.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 26.7% black. It has a hue angle of 233.4 degrees, a saturation of 57.1% and a lightness of 46.7%. #3342bb color hex could be obtained by blending #6684ff with #000077. Closest websafe color is: #3333cc.

#3342bb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#3342bb has RGB values of R:51, G:66, B:187 and CMYK values of C:0.73, M:0.65, Y:0, K:0.27. Its decimal value is 3359419.
